REGI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

5 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Renewable Energy Group, Inc. (REGI)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$11.3M — down 100% from $2.7B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 265 funds closed out of REGI and 2 opened new positions — a net loss of 263 holders — while 1 trimmed existing stakes and 0 added.

The largest buyer was Huntington National Bank, opening a new position worth an estimated $61. The largest seller was BlackRock, exiting entirely with an estimated $592M sold.
